Hello, I have received the nomination from Ontario province and my total score is now 1005 in which 600 is for Ontario province nomination and 405 my individual. Ive already got the ITA from CIC and I've to submit my documents in next 90 days.I'm soon to get married and my fiance has already cleared IELTS exam but if I add her in my profile after getting married, my individual score cuts down to 397 instead of 405 and Ontario needs minimum 400. My question is if I add her and my total score becoming 997 which includes my individual score of 397 will still be eligible for ITA or my nomination will be cancelled?? Plz help me out.

Sorry, but this is something that I found on Application guide of OINP
"It is your responsibility as an applicant to ensure that you update your information in the Express Entry portal if there is a change in your circumstances so that your CRS score is accurately calculated. If a change in circumstance results in your CRS score falling below 400, it is your responsibility to inform OINP. If your score falls below 400 before you have been nominated, you must withdraw your nominee application. If your CRS score falls below 400 after you have already been nominated, but before you apply for Permanent Residence, you must inform OINP of the change in your CRS score, at which point OINP will withdraw your nomination. Note that failure to contact OINP if your CRS score falls below 400 will result in a refusal of your Application for Permanent Residence by IRCC"

Hi, sorry to hear that and I hope my reply doesn't offend or hurt you. I say accept your ITA rather than rejecting it as the process looks very laborious and time consuming one. Now, i'm sure she can be taken on a wheel chair post surgery. As a part of medical exams , you need to be taking routine urine analysis, serum analysis (including HIV & other STDs), Chest X-ray (for TB), Hypertension, diabetes, kidney related and other autoimmune disorders and any other worth findings from the panel of doctors. So, all these should go well for your spouse except that she cant walk for a while. As these are one time test and the results are valid for 12 months. fractures of your wife shouldn't really affect her medicals and I'm sure doctors would recommend the same. By the time she is normal, you will have a PR.
